Outdoor Swimming Pools, Tubs, Showers Decking Patio, Porch, Deck Stone Fences, Walls Walkways Large Patio, Porch, Deck Landscape Lighting Stone Patio, Porch, Deck Design Photos and Ideas

Exterior with infinity pool-VILLA CP